IBM has announced the development of a new quantum computing chip, named "Loon." The company says this chip is a major step toward developing quantum computers that can be used for real-world purposes by 2029.

IBM's New Approach
Major companies like Google, Amazon, and IBM are working to correct these errors. In 2021, IBM proposed a new approach: apply algorithms similar to those used to improve signals in mobile networks to quantum computers. To achieve this, they planned to combine ordinary and quantum chips. However, this makes creating quantum chips a little more difficult, as they now require not only quantum bits (qubits) but also new types of connections between them.
Where is this chip made?
According to IBM, the Loon chip was developed at the Albany Nanotech Complex in New York. This location is considered one of the most advanced chip factories in the world.
Future Plans
Currently, Loon is in its early stages, and IBM has not announced when the public or developers will be able to test it. However, the company has announced another chip, "Nighthawk," which will be available by the end of this year. IBM believes that Nighthawk can outperform ordinary computers in some tasks by next year. The company is working with researchers and startups to share its code openly so that anyone can test it. "We believe that quantum computers will offer breakthroughs in many areas in the future," said IBM director Jay Gambetta. "But we want this to be more than just news, but to be a community that tests the code itself and finds real solutions."
